Location address


You can find Subway at 12620 Tamiami Trl, Naples, FL 34113, United States. The public transportation and parking near 12620 Tamiami Trl, Naples, FL 34113, United States are also listed on it.

Map

More restaurants near Subway

These restaurants are in the vicinity of 12620 Tamiami Trl, Naples, FL 34113, United States.

4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Naples, 699 Fifth Ave. South Naples, FL 34102, United States
"Amazing restaurant. One of my favorites, we’ll be back."
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Naples, 1490 5th Ave S Unit 101, 34102, Naples, US, 34102-3495, United States
"Lovely place great, interesting entrees!"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Naples, 755 12th Avenue SouthFL 34102, Naples, United States
"Outstanding!! It is all about the great food!"
4.7
Menu
Table booking
Open Now
4.7
Menu
Table booking
Open Now
City: Naples, Neapolitan Shopping Center, Naples I-3410, United States
"This restaurant shows itself as one of the better restaurants in the environment. After I tried, I agree. the service was absolutely great and eating..."
4.6
Menu
Table booking
Open Now
4.6
Menu
Table booking
Open Now
City: Naples, 1186 Third Street South Naples, FL 34102, 34102-7085, United States
"Server Teva is outstanding. He is the best server in Campiello."
4.6
Menu
Table booking
Open Now
4.6
Menu
Table booking
Open Now
City: Naples, Naples, 821 5th Ave S, 34102-6617, United States
"Delicious breakfasts. Wonderful service. Great location."
4.4
Menu
Table booking
Open Now
4.4
Menu
Table booking
Open Now
City: Naples, Naples, 1177 3rd St S, 34102-7095, United States
"Yummy special July lunch menu. Our server Anaya was great!"
4.5
Menu
Table booking
Open Now
4.5
Menu
Table booking
Open Now
City: Naples, 536 Tamiami Trl N, Naples, United States
"Very good but a bit pricey to get a personalized pizza"
4.4
Menu
Table booking
Open Now
4.4
Menu
Table booking
Open Now
City: Naples, 462 5th Ave S, Naples, United States
"Delish! Absolutely wonderful from start to finish, both in the restaurant and in the bar. We visited Tulia two years ago for a birthday party with the..."
4.3
Menu
Table booking
Open Now
4.3
Menu
Table booking
Open Now
City: Naples, 2891 Bayview DrFL 34112, Naples, United States
"Went with my parents, absolutely amazing meal!"